Shopportunist: Enjoy these free summer movies

0

If you need a bit more help fleshing out a summer of frugal family fun, how about a few hours with singing swine, snarky superheroes or a video game bad guy who ventures into the wild World Wide Web to save a friend?

Once again, national movie theater chains, municipalities and local arts venues are hosting free (or super-cheap) movie series over the coming weeks. So clip and keep this list and carve out a summer of cinema fun.

Regal Cinemas

The mega-chain's Summer Movie Express family movie series kicks off at Regal Crossgates Stadium 18 & IMAX and Regal Clifton Park Stadium.

Admission is only $1. Tickets are available for purchase at the box office and all movies start at 10 a.m. Tuesdays and Wednesdays. Each week both movies play on both days. A portion of the proceeds goes to the Will Rogers Institute.

June 25-26: "Teen Titans Go! To the Movies" and "Paddington 2"

July 2-3: "Despicable Me 3" and "Dr. Seuss' The Grinch"

July 9-10: "Lego Movie 2" and "How to Train Your Dragon: The Hidden World"

July 16-17: "Smallfoot" and "Secret Life of Pets"

July 23-24: "The Lego Movie" and "Captain Underpants"

July 30-31: "Sing" and "How to Train Your Dragon 2"

Aug. 6-7: "Penguins of Madagascar" and "Boss Baby"

Aug. 13-14: "Kung Fu Panda 3" and "Lego Ninjago Movie"

Aug. 20-21: "Trolls" and "Minions"

Aug. 27-28: "Madagascar" and "Shrek 2"

Sept. 3-4: "How to Train Your Dragon" and "Storks"
